Exporting to Europe? Make sure you have the right advice

The UK is one of the largest economies in the world and, as an island nation, is dependent on exports to drive the economy.

Since the new Brexit rules have come into place, governing how we trade with the EU, the nation has also faced uncertainty over the value of the pound and war in Europe making conditions more challenging for exporters.

Despite this, figures from the Office for National Statistics (ONS) in August show total exports of goods, excluding precious metals, increased by £0.4 billion (1.2 per cent). This was driven by a £0.7 billion (4.1 per cent) increase in exports to non-EU countries, while exports to EU countries decreased by £0.3 billion (1.5 per cent).

Still struggling to trade with the EU?

The Export Support Service is an online helpline service where all UK businesses can get answers to practical questions about exporting to Europe.

Its advice covers:

  • Exporting to new markets
  • Any paperwork that is now needed to move your exports to Europe
  • Information on the rules for a specific country where you want to sell services

A ‘one-stop shop’, it brings together UK Government information, making it easier for exporters to access advice and support.

There are several areas where exporters can seek advice, including:

  • Guidance on recognising professional qualifications
  • The paperwork that will be needed to sell your goods abroad
  • How to navigate licences, certificates, and authorisations
  • Detailed advice on exporting to new markets
  • How to make supplementary, export, and customs import declarations
  • Rules of origin queries
  • Rules for a specific country or product, such as food, drink, medicinal, pharmaceutical, or animal-derived goods.
